Once, an electrical distributor installed inside a cabinet, along with a two-wire radar level gauge, produced a 4–20mA signal of around 18mA when sending it to the PLC; this value was higher than the actual liquid level. During on-site inspection, the level gauge had a supply voltage of 18.6V and an output of 10mA at multiple points. During line inspection, it was found that when the circuit was open at the site, the resistance measured at the distributor end was over 1 kΩ. It works normally after replacing the cable core wire.
During one of my shifts, the readings from an electromagnetic flowmeter kept fluctuating. When I went to the site to check, everything seemed normal. I checked the grounding wires as well, and they were fine too. Then I swapped one of the signal wires with another nearby wire; after that, the readings became normal again. Once I switched the wires back to their original positions, the fluctuations stopped. To this day, I still don’t understand why that happened
